漬 is the Japanese kanji for pickling, soak, moisten, steep. It is written with 14 strokes and appears at JLPT level N1. Its kun reading is つ.ける、つ.かる、-づ.け and its on reading is シ.

Words with 漬
- 漬けるto soak (in), to steep, to dip
- 漬かるto be submerged, to be soaked
- 漬物tsukemono (pickled vegetables)
- 塩漬けpickling in salt, food preserved in salt
- 茶漬けchazuke, cooked rice with green tea poured on it
